Household of Kornelis Zwart

He is married to Harmanna Margaretha Visser.Sources 1, 2, 3, 4, 7,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12, 13, 14, 15, 16, 17, 18, 19, 20

They got married on May 16, 1896 at Ulrum, Groningen, Nederland, he was 29 years old. They were 29 years old and 26 years old, respectively.Source 21


Child(ren):

  1. Sibbeltje Zwart  1897-1992 
  2. Roelf Zwart  1898-1907
  3. Janna Zwart  1900-1906
  4. Jan Zwart  1901-1985 
  5. - Zwart  1903
  6. Simon Zwart  1904-< 1999 
  7. Janna Zwart  1907-1997 
  8. Regina Zwart  1908-1996 
  9. Tjaarke Zwart  1910-1999 
  10. Jantje Zwart  1913-1914
